JOHN I10585 Thomas, Christopher, William, Oliver, William, Alexander, John II, John I, Oliver, Alexander, John I, Roger, John, Roger, Thomas, John, Ralph, Wimund II, Wimund I, Ansfrid II “Mathew Stoniston sone of Thomas Shonson beneth”1 was baptized April 13, 1590, St. Andrew’s Holborn, Camden, London, England.2 Familysearch.org has this record indexed under Stevnson or Stenneson.3 Record 1 Baptism: [13 Apr 1590] Mathew Stoniston sone of Thomas Shonson beneth the 13 day He was the third child and second son of THOMAS ST. JOHN and JANE MATHEW. He was most likely named, as the second son, after his mother’s surname. This seems to be a custom that appears among landed gentry and in several St. John generations. The first son is usually named after the paternal family by either taking the father or grandfather or current tenement-in- chief’s name and the second son takes the mother’s surname as a first name. With his father, Thomas, being a younger son himself, his marriage to the female heir of the Mathew family offered Thomas or one of his sons a greater chance of rising himself to tenant-in-chief of the Mathew estate.
